A 70-year-old woman in the US accidentally drove her SUV onto an elevated light rail track while following GPS directions, leaving stunned commuters watching as a car rolled into a train station where only rail vehicles are supposed to go.
The bizarre incident unfolded at Seattle's Mount Baker light rail station on Tuesday evening, when a red Mazda C 5 slowly made its way onto the southbound platform, disrupting train services and sparking a flood of viral videos online.
According to a report by The Seattle Times, passengers waiting for a train were left bewildered as the SUV emerged on the tracks and pulled up near the station platform.
Police later said the woman told officers she had been following navigation instructions when she mistakenly ended up on the rail line.
Investigators are still trying to determine the exact route she took to reach the station.
